A Base Transceiver Station (BTS) uses Time Division Multiple Access (TDMA) and Frequency Division Multiple Access (FDMA) to communicate with multiple subscribers at the same time. TDMA allocates time slots for each user, while FDMA assigns separate frequency bands. (User can only transmit r receive in subscriber and base station. Diqing solar power generation repair price
Repairing your photovoltaic (PV) system typically costs between $250 to $1,700, but many factors can add additional costs. Roofing contractors charge a minimum of $100 per service for minor fixes like an epoxy patch, while a high-end solar inverter replacement could set you back. . The type of solar panel repair is a key cost driver, with cracked or broken panels costing $120 to $550, wiring repairs ranging from $100 to $400, and inverter replacement costing from $150 to $3,000. Roof-related work can add significant expense, with leak fixes costing $360 to $1,550 and hail. . On average, you can spend anywhere from $300 - $800 or more for a typical solar panel maintenance. Which solar photovoltaic panel is better for home use
Monocrystalline solar panels offer the best performance with 20% or higher efficiency rates and 25-35 year lifespans, though they cost more than polycrystalline panels which provide 15-17% efficiency at lower prices. .
